Media Monitor: New Technologies Emerge to Challenge AI's Transformer Foundation
MIT Technology Review reports that the foundational transformer architecture in large language models is showing its age, prompting startups like Subquadratic, Manifest AI, Liquid AI, Inception, and Pathway to develop new, more efficient AI technologies.

Media Monitor: AI Models Develop Own Biases, Stereotype Job Applicants More Than Humans
MIT Technology Review reports new research from Princeton and University of Chicago shows large language models can develop their own biases, stereotyping job applicants more severely than humans in simulated hiring.

Media Monitor: AI startup Subquadratic's LLM claims gain traction with independent tests, MIT Technology Review reports
MIT Technology Review reports on Subquadratic, an AI startup claiming a breakthrough in large language models. Independent tests by Appen suggest its SubQ model is faster, cheaper, and more efficient, addressing initial skepticism.
